Composite and plastic lumber deck boards sold in North America are rated under ASTM D7032, a specification maintained by ASTM International that establishes performance ratings for deck boards, stair treads, guards and handrails. The standard sets out the test methods a product must pass before it can be recognized under model building codes, and it applies across the category rather than to any single manufacturer.

Those methods include flexural testing, temperature and moisture effects, ultraviolet resistance, freeze-thaw resistance, biodeterioration and fire performance. Deck boards are additionally evaluated for creep-recovery, allowable load, mechanical fastener holding and slip resistance. Three of those categories, ultraviolet resistance, freeze-thaw resistance and moisture effects, correspond directly to the conditions decks encounter in the region.

The standard itself notes that composites should not be assumed to behave like wood. It states that structural, physical and fire attributes may differ because of the presence, type and quantity of plastic in the composite, and it includes specific provisions addressing sensitivity to temperature, ultraviolet exposure and freeze-thaw cycling.
That distinction matters at the point of installation. Framing layouts, fastening methods and spacing practices developed for lumber do not transfer automatically to composite products, which is why the standard evaluates fastener holding and thermal behavior as separate categories rather than assuming performance carries over from wood.
Individual product results are published in evaluation reports issued by ICC Evaluation Service, which are searchable and free to read. Those reports identify the manufacturer, the product line and the span rating assigned, allowing a property owner to look up the specific boards named in a quote rather than relying on general category descriptions or marketing material.
Span rating is the figure most directly tied to construction. It indicates the maximum distance a board may span between supports for a given end use, which in turn determines joist spacing beneath the surface. Boards carrying different span ratings require different framing layouts, which is why the rating functions as a structural specification rather than a product feature.
The distinction becomes practical when a homeowner changes material after framing has been planned. A board with a shorter span rating than the one a deck was designed around requires closer joist spacing, and that is a framing decision rather than a surface one. Reviewing the rating before framing begins avoids revisiting the structure later.
Slip resistance and biodeterioration are the categories most often overlooked. Slip resistance affects surfaces near pools or in areas that stay damp, while biodeterioration testing addresses the biological growth that develops on decking held in prolonged shade or moisture. Neither is visible in a showroom sample, and both describe conditions common on north-facing decks and those under heavy tree cover.

The standard covers a range of formulations, including polyvinyl chloride boards, polyethylene-based composites containing wood fiber, and polypropylene blends, in both solid and hollow cross-sections. Products within that range vary considerably in density and moisture absorption, which is why each formulation is tested according to its own composition and intended structural application rather than against a single category benchmark.
Property owners can review the test categories through the ASTM D7032 listing on the ASTM International website and search product-specific results through the ICC Evaluation Service directory.
